Output e5f88ec28565e12bea1816029de6f54f5f4885e6a34ac0fad9d6e6c2a38f077c:0

value
30405531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b934ecc673c152c1142332895a3bcf52f0e31e9e OP_EQUALVERIFY OP_CHECKSIG
address
1HtHQmyL1NcfcdsLiZCNQ1v4ic1uUq312a
transaction
e5f88ec28565e12bea1816029de6f54f5f4885e6a34ac0fad9d6e6c2a38f077c
confirmations
567506
spent
true